To find a linear equation that has the same solution set as \( \frac{9d}{4} + 3 - 2d = -2(3 + d) \), we need to first simplify this equation.
Starting with the original equation:
1. Distribute the right-hand side:
\[
\frac{9d}{4} + 3 - 2d = -6 - 2d
\]
2. Add \(2d\) to both sides:
\[
\frac{9d}{4} + 3 = -6
\]
3. Move \(3\) to the right-hand side:
\[
\frac{9d}{4} = -9
\]
4. Multiply both sides by \(4\):
\[
9d = -36
\]
5. Divide by \(9\):
\[
d = -4
\]
Now we have determined the solution \(d = -4\). Let's analyze the choices given and see which one simplifies to the same solution:
1. **Option 1**:
\[
14 = \frac{7}{4}x - \frac{19}{4} + 2x
\]
This needs to be investigated further.
2. **Option 2**:
\[
4w - 2(7 - 3w) = \frac{w}{3} - 6
\]
This also requires investigation.
3. **Option 3**:
\[
\frac{3x}{5} - 10 = -7
\]
Let's try solving this one:
- Add \(10\) to both sides:
\[
\frac{3x}{5} = 3
\]
- Multiply by \(5\):
\[
3x = 15
\]
- Divide by \(3\):
\[
x = 5
\]
This does not match.
4. **Option 4**:
\[
35 - 15b = 95
\]
Solving:
- Subtract \(35\):
\[
-15b = 60
\]
- Dividing by \(-15\):
\[
b = -4
\]
This matches our solution.
Thus, the linear equation that has the same solution set as \( \frac{9d}{4} + 3 - 2d = -2(3 + d) \) is:
\[
\boxed{35 - 15b = 95}
\]
